The term "Folate pathway modulation" refers broadly to therapeutic strategies that alter the activity of components within the cellular pathways responsible for processing and utilizing **folic acid**. This includes targeting enzymes essential for one-carbon transfer reactions required for DNA/RNA synthesis and methylation processes critical for gene expression regulation. Modulation can also involve targeting membrane proteins responsible for transporting or binding extracellular folates—most notably **folate receptors** such as FRα—which are overexpressed on certain tumor cells including ovarian cancer, making them attractive candidates for targeted drug delivery using antibody-drug conjugates or small-molecule conjugates. Drugs that modulate this pathway are used primarily in oncology but also have roles in treating autoimmune diseases by affecting immune cell proliferation. However, because these pathways are fundamental to normal cellular function—especially during development—therapeutic intervention carries risks including cytopenias, mucositis, organ toxicities, and teratogenic effects.
Depending on drug class—Inhibition of key enzymes in the folate cycle such as dihydrofolate reductase or thymidylate synthase by antifolates blocks DNA synthesis/proliferation in rapidly dividing cells. Targeted delivery via conjugation to drugs that bind cell-surface receptors like FRα for selective uptake into cancer cells ("Trojan Horse" mechanism).
